WALKING WITH GOD

SCRIPTURE: Before I formed thee in the belly I knew thee…. – Jeremiah 1:5

THOUGHT FOR THE DAY: God who created you knows your future more than you know your past.

Walking is a necessary requirement of life. God created us to walk with Him. To walk with God is to walk into your future. To walk independent of God is to walk away from your destiny. You cannot walk with God and miss it in life, because God who created you knows your future more than you know your past.

What Is The Impact Of Walking With God?
1. Walking with God makes you see things from God’s perspective. It is like flying with an eagle. You see things further and clearer when you walk with God. He makes you see from His perspective.

That is why men and women who walk with God do not see impossibilities.

2. It causes God to inject your mind with His plan and purpose for your life. Walking with God gives you the privilege of confirmation and reconfirmations of His purpose for your life.

By coming to God’s presence, He reminds you of what He had told you that you either forgot or tried and failed. Walking with God brings you back to your Bethel.

I decree today: As you walk with God, what God wants to you to do with your life shall become clearer and clearer in Jesus’ name.

Remember this: God who created you knows your future more than you know your past.
